Abstract: The invention concerns a catalyst composition which is free from noble metals and is obtained by: a) preparing an aqueous mixture which comprises: i) a salt of at least one base metal selected from elements having the atomic numbers 21 to 32, 39 to 42, 48 to 51, 57 to 75 and 81 to 83; ii) phosphate ions; and iii) at least one nitrogen source; and b) concentrating the aqueous mixture produced and drying the resultant catalyst compound. The invention further concerns the preparation of this composition and its use in the production of hydrogen peroxide and the epoxidation of olefins.

Abstract: The invention concerns a grid catalyst based on titanium zeolite or vanadium zeolite and on inert reticulated fabrics suitable for use in the catalysis of oxidation reactions such as the epoxidation of olefins, the production of hydrogen peroxide or the synthesis of hydroxylamine.

Abstract: The invention relates to a process for the preparation of chlorofluorocarbon-free (CFC-free), elastomeric, semi-rigid or rigid mouldings containing urethane groups or urethane and urea groups and having a cellular core and a compacted peripheral zone with an essentially pore-free, smooth surface, by reacting a) organic and/or modified organic polyisocyanates with b) at least one relatively high-molecular-weight compound containing at least two reactive hydrogen atoms and optionally c) low-molecular-weight chain extenders and/or crosslinking agents, in the presence of d) blowing agents, e) catalysts, f) at least one microporous activated charcoal and/or a microporous carbon molecular sieve, which preferably has a mean pore diameter with more than 40% in the range from 0.3 to 3 nm, a pore volume of from 0.20 to 1.4 ml/g and a BET surface area of from 500 to 2500 m /g or greater, and optionally further additives and g) auxiliaries, in a closed mould with compaction.

Abstract: The prodn. of aliphatic and cycloaliphatic oximes (1) comprises reacting the corresp. imine (2) with oxygen or oxygen-contg. gas in the presence of a catalyst, except for catalysts of formula (Tix(M*D1-x)(2n/3*E1-x))O2 (I), where D = Si or Ge; E = Ce of Al; x = 0.06-0.9; m = 1 if n = 0; m = 0 if n = 1. Also claimed is a process for the prodn. of (1) comprising (a) imination of the corresp. ketone with ammonia by known methods followed by (b) catalytic oxidn. of the imine as above.

Abstract: A Phillips catalyst for the polymerization of alpha -olefins, containing, as a catalytically active component, at least one chromium(III) compound on a silicon aluminum phosphate carrier of the general formula (I) (SixAlyPz)O2(I) where x is from 0.05 to 0.5 and y and z are each from 0.1 to 1.0, exhibits in particular high productivity and is preferably used for the preparation of homo- and copolymers of ethylene.

Abstract: The invention relates to a process for the preparation of CFC-free, soft and elastic, semi-rigid or rigid mouldings containing urethane groups and having a cellular core and a compacted peripheral zone with an essentially pore-free, smooth surface, by reacting a) organic and/or modified organic polyisocyanates with b) at least one relatively high-molecular-weight compound containing at least two reactive hydrogen atoms and optionally c) low-molecular-weight chain extenders and/or crosslinking agents, in the presence of d) blowing agents, e) catalysts, f) at least one amorphous, microporous silica gel which preferably has a mean pore diameter with more than 40 % in range from 0.1 to 10 nm, a pore volume of from 0.15 to 1.8 ml/g and a BET surface area of from 200 to 900 m /g, and optionally further additives, and g) assistants, in a closed mould with compaction. t

Abstract: Preparation of a solid (I) containing silicon dioxide includes the stage of contacting at least one precursor (II) for SiO2 with at least one structure former in a liquid medium. The novelty is that the structure former comprises a polyethyleneimine (PEI) or a mixture of two or more PEI's. Also claimed are (I) obtained by the process; and the use of PEI (or a mixture of PEI's) as structure former in the preparation of solids containing SiO2.

Abstract: The invention relates to a method for regenerating a zeolitic catalyst, comprising the following steps: (I) at least one partially deactivated catalyst is heated to a temperature ranging from 250 to 600 DEG C in an atmosphere containing less than 2 vol. % oxygen; (II) the catalyst is impinged upon by a gas flow at a temperature ranging from 250 to 800 DEG C, preferably 350 to 600 DEG C, said gas flow having an oxygen-delivering substance content or an oxygen content or a mixture of two or more thereof ranging from 0.1 to 4 vol. % and (III) the catalyst is impinged upon by a gas flow at a temperature ranging from 250 to 800 DEG C, preferably 350 to 600 DEG C, said gas flow having an oxygen-delivering substance content or an oxygen content or a mixture of two or more thereof ranging from over 4 to 100 vol. %.
